Discover the cozy elegance of this charming 2-bedroom, 1-bathroom home spanning 1,277 (+/-) square feet, nestled in Downtown San Jose. This single-family haven greets you with a welcoming living space seamlessly transitioning into a dining area, adorned with recent high-end wood flooring. Prepare your culinary delights in a kitchen replete with modern charm, featuring white cabinetry, granite countertops, stainless steel appliances, and recessed lighting. Entertainment options abound, whether you choose the downstairs refinished basement, perfect for a family room or home office, or the charming backyard featuring a mature orange tree. The home comprises two generously sized bedrooms, a remodeled bathroom, and notable features such as an upgraded tankless water heater, new windows, new copper plumbing, updated light fixtures, and central AC for an enhanced comfort. Conveniently located near Japantown, access to HWY 101/880/17 is effortless, while weekends offer opportunities to explore the vibrant nightlife, diverse eateries, farmers markets, and cozy cafes dotting the downtown landscape.
